Accommodations nearby Stowford, Okehampton EX20 4BZ, UK

Stowford Barton Farm

Approximately 0 km away
Address: Stowford, Okehampton EX20 4BZ, UK

The Granary

Approximately 1.69 km away
Address: Lewdown nr. Okehampton EX20 4QY, UK

Blue Lion Inn

Approximately 1.96 km away
Address: Lewdown, Okehampton EX20 4DL, UK